Falmouth Town slumped to a heavy defeat away at in-form Ivybridge in the South West Peninsula League premier division.
John Dent's side were on the wrong end of a 4-0 scoreline against the high-flying Bridgers, who move into second spot in the league following Bodmin Town's 1-0 win over Plymouth Parkway.
Defeat sees Town hovering precariously over the drop zone, just a single point above Tavistock - who have three games in hand - and four points ahead of basement club Liskeard, who were thrashed 5-0 by St Blazey.
And it doesn't get any easier for beleaguered Town; they host third place Exmouth at Bickland Park next weekend.
Eslewhere in the premier division Launceston beat Bovey Tracey 2-0, and Tavsitock drew 2-2 with Elburton Villa.
